English

Etymology

Blend of kaput +‎ poof. Perhaps influenced by the ka- prefix (which is a variant of ker-).

Interjection

kapoof

  1. (informal) Used to indicate that something has gone awry and vanished at the same time.
    Not long after childhood his acting career suddenly went kapoof.
